要创建一个强大的在线投票平台,你可以使用PHP编程语言来实现。下面是一个简单的示例代码,用于展示如何创建一个基本的投票平台:
首先,创建一个数据库来存储投票相关的数据。可以使用MySQL或其他关系型数据库来存储数据。
在数据库中创建两个表格:一个用于存储投票主题和选项,另一个用于存储投票结果。
创建一个PHP文件,用于处理用户的投票请求。在该文件中,你可以编写代码来接收用户的投票选择,并将其存储到数据库中。
<?php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 处理投票请求
if(isset($_POST['vote'])) {
$vote = $_POST['vote'];
// 将投票结果存储到数据库中
$sql = "INSERT INTO votes (option_id) VALUES ('$vote')";
mysqli_query($conn, $sql);
}
// 获取投票结果
$sql = "SELECT option_id, COUNT(*) as count FROM votes GROUP BY option_id";
$result = mysqli_query($conn, $sql);
// 显示投票结果
while($row = mysqli_fetch_assoc($result)) {
echo "选项ID:" . $row['option_id'] . ",投票数:" . $row['count'] . "<br>";
}
// 关闭数据库连接
mysqli_close($conn);
?>
<form action="vote.php" method="post">
<input type="radio" name="vote" value="1"> 选项1<br>
<input type="radio" name="vote" value="2"> 选项2<br>
<input type="radio" name="vote" value="3"> 选项3<br>
<input type="submit" value="投票">
</form>
以上代码只是一个简单的示例,你可以根据自己的需求进行修改和扩展。例如,你可以添加用户注册和登录功能,以及更复杂的投票选项和结果展示方式。
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3
Laravel 中文站